json.sync

Question about WAPT Server / Requêtes et aides autour du serveur Wapt
Règles du forum
Règles du forum communautaire
* English support on www.reddit.com/r/wapt
* Le support communautaire en français se fait sur ce forum
* Merci de préfixer le titre du topic par [RESOLU] s'il est résolu.
* Merci de ne pas modifier un topic qui est taggé [RESOLU]. Ouvrez un nouveau topic en référençant l'ancien
* Préciser version de WAPT installée, version complète ET numéro de build (2.2.1.11957 / 2.2.2.12337 / etc.) AINSI QUE l'édition Enterprise / Discovery
* Les versions 1.8.2 et antérieures ne sont plus maintenues. Les seules questions acceptées vis à vis de la version 1.8.2 sont liés à la mise à jour vers une version supportée (2.1, 2.2, etc.)
* Préciser OS du serveur (Linux / Windows) et version (Debian Buster/Bullseye - CentOS 7 - Windows Server 2012/2016/2019)
* Préciser OS de la machine d'administration/création des paquets et de la machine avec l'agent qui pose problème le cas échéant (Windows 7 / 10 / 11 / Debian 11 / etc.)
* Eviter de poser plusieurs questions lors de l'ouverture de topic, sinon il risque d'être ignorer. Si plusieurs sujet, ouvrir plusieurs topic, et de préférence les uns après les autres et pas tous en même temps (ie ne pas spammer le forum).
* Inclure directement les morceaux de code, les captures d'écran et autres images directement dans le post. Les liens vers les pastebin, les bitly et autres sites tierces seront systématiquement supprimés.
* Comme tout forum communautaire, le support est fait bénévolement par les membres. Si vous avez besoin d'un support commercial, vous pouvez contacter le service commercial Tranquil IT au 02.40.97.57.55
jdziadek
Messages : 47
Inscription : 23 janv. 2023 - 16:10

13 mars 2023 - 14:38

Hello, mon json.sync coté serveur est n'est pas raccord avec les fichiers que j'ai dessus., il liste des anciens paquets et pas les nouveaux, donc forcement, sur mes dépôts distants ca foire. Comment le régénérer proprement?
Julien
Debian 11
WAPT Version : 2.4.0.14143
Avatar de l’utilisateur
sfonteneau
Expert WAPT
Messages : 1783
Inscription : 10 juil. 2014 - 23:52
Contact :

13 mars 2023 - 16:06

Bonjour

Ce fichier est générer coter serveur par le service "wapttasks", vous pouvez essayer de relancer le service wapttasks

Ensuite sur la console vous pouvez cliquer dans l'onglet "dépôt secondaires" -> "Mettre à jour l'index"

Simon Fonteneau
Avatar de l’utilisateur
sfonteneau
Expert WAPT
Messages : 1783
Inscription : 10 juil. 2014 - 23:52
Contact :

13 mars 2023 - 16:08

Attention, le sync.json est créer a partir de la somme de fichier (ça prend donc du temps et du cpu du manière temporaire)
jdziadek
Messages : 47
Inscription : 23 janv. 2023 - 16:10

14 mars 2023 - 08:13

sfonteneau a écrit : 13 mars 2023 - 16:06 Bonjour

Ce fichier est générer coter serveur par le service "wapttasks", vous pouvez essayer de relancer le service wapttasks

Ensuite sur la console vous pouvez cliquer dans l'onglet "dépôt secondaires" -> "Mettre à jour l'index"

Simon Fonteneau
Hello, merci de la réponse, ce que j'ai fais hier, j'ai supprimé le fichier, j'ai fais un
touch json.sync
, j'ai attribué les bons droits. Dans la console ca m'a indiqué que le fichier n'était pas bon, la console m'a indiqué "fichier manquant" pendant environ 1h, et la ca fait un bon 16H que j'ai "création du json" sur ma console, et le fichier fait toujours 0 octets. Par contre je n'ai jamais vu le bouton pour recréer l'index
Debian 11
WAPT Version : 2.4.0.14143
Avatar de l’utilisateur
sfonteneau
Expert WAPT
Messages : 1783
Inscription : 10 juil. 2014 - 23:52
Contact :

14 mars 2023 - 09:58

Avez vous bien des repo secondaire qui apparaisse dans la console ?


Sinon sur le serveur vous pouvez lancer le wapttasks en mode debug pour voir ce qu'il dit puis cliquer sur "mettre à jour l'index des paquets)
(pas d'indication de la version de wapt ni de l'os dans votre message je vais donc supposer donc que vous êtes en linux debian dernière version cf forum rules)

Code : Tout sélectionner

[root@srvwapt.mydom ~]# systemctl stop wapttasks
[root@srvwapt.mydom ~]# /opt/wapt/runwapttasks.sh 
[2023-03-14 09:55:45,216] INFO:huey.consumer:MainThread:Huey consumer started with 2 thread, PID 2215287 at 2023-03-14 09:55:45.216402
[2023-03-14 09:55:45,216] INFO:huey.consumer:MainThread:Scheduler runs every 1 second(s).
[2023-03-14 09:55:45,217] INFO:huey.consumer:MainThread:Periodic tasks are enabled.
[2023-03-14 09:55:45,217] INFO:huey.consumer:MainThread:The following commands are available:
+ waptserver.tasks.resign_crl
+ waptserver.repositories_tasks.update_file_tree_of_files_in_huey
+ waptserver.wsus_tasks.download_wsusscan
+ waptserver.wsus_tasks.download_wsusscan_crontab
+ waptserver.wsus_tasks.cleanup_delete_non_assigned_kb
+ waptserver.wsus_tasks.download_windows_update_task
+ waptserver.wsus_tasks.download_missing_cabs
[2023-03-14 09:55:57,126] INFO:huey:Worker-2:Executing waptserver.repositories_tasks.update_file_tree_of_files_in_huey: 2aee79df-f46a-4ef9-b7ef-5570080ae9d0
[2023-03-14 09:55:57,139] INFO:huey:Worker-2:waptserver.repositories_tasks.update_file_tree_of_files_in_huey: 2aee79df-f46a-4ef9-b7ef-5570080ae9d0 executed in 0.013s
jdziadek
Messages : 47
Inscription : 23 janv. 2023 - 16:10

14 mars 2023 - 11:05

Je suis bien en debian 11 sur la dernière version. Le redémarrage de service n'a rien fait, par contre la routine à l'heure de s'être lancé a 9h00 pile, ( un cron qui tourne ? )
Depuis le bouton est bien apparu dans la console et le serveur me propose " TO RESSYNC" sur mon dépôt secondaire.
J'appuie sur le bouton " mettre à jour l'index", j'ai bien la meme chose dans les logs :

Code : Tout sélectionner

2023-03-14 11:01:02,335] INFO:huey.consumer:MainThread:Huey consumer started with 2 thread, PID 880268 at 2023-03-14 11:01:02.335857
[2023-03-14 11:01:02,336] INFO:huey.consumer:MainThread:Scheduler runs every 1 second(s).
[2023-03-14 11:01:02,336] INFO:huey.consumer:MainThread:Periodic tasks are enabled.
[2023-03-14 11:01:02,336] INFO:huey.consumer:MainThread:The following commands are available:
+ waptserver.tasks.resign_crl
+ waptserver.repositories_tasks.update_file_tree_of_files_in_huey
+ waptserver.wsus_tasks.download_wsusscan
+ waptserver.wsus_tasks.download_wsusscan_crontab
+ waptserver.wsus_tasks.cleanup_delete_non_assigned_kb
+ waptserver.wsus_tasks.download_windows_update_task
+ waptserver.wsus_tasks.download_missing_cabs
[2023-03-14 11:02:00,103] INFO:huey:Worker-1:Executing waptserver.repositories_tasks.update_file_tree_of_files_in_huey: 2d76a36a-071f-4755-83ea-0f4b265eafc3
[2023-03-14 11:02:01,084] INFO:huey:Worker-1:waptserver.repositories_tasks.update_file_tree_of_files_in_huey: 2d76a36a-071f-4755-83ea-0f4b265eafc3 executed in 0.980s
Par contre la synchro n'a pas l'air de se déclencher quand je clique sur les boutons

Edit : Bon la synchro s'effectue bien, mais par contre je n'ai toujours pas la main au niveau de la console. Il reste a " To ressync"
Debian 11
WAPT Version : 2.4.0.14143
Avatar de l’utilisateur
sfonteneau
Expert WAPT
Messages : 1783
Inscription : 10 juil. 2014 - 23:52
Contact :

14 mars 2023 - 12:11

le sync.json est ok du coup ? (avant de vérifier autre chose)
jdziadek
Messages : 47
Inscription : 23 janv. 2023 - 16:10

14 mars 2023 - 13:08

Oui, le fichier json.sync est bon, la réplication c'est bien effectué sur mon dépot distant. Mais pour la console c'est encore dans les choux " TO RESSYNC"
julien
Debian 11
WAPT Version : 2.4.0.14143
Avatar de l’utilisateur
sfonteneau
Expert WAPT
Messages : 1783
Inscription : 10 juil. 2014 - 23:52
Contact :

14 mars 2023 - 14:35

Vous avez mis une limite horaire dans la synchro ?

Vous pouvez utiliser le bouton "Forcer la synchro" dans le clique droit
jdziadek
Messages : 47
Inscription : 23 janv. 2023 - 16:10

14 mars 2023 - 19:26

sfonteneau a écrit : 14 mars 2023 - 14:35 Vous avez mis une limite horaire dans la synchro ?

Vous pouvez utiliser le bouton "Forcer la synchro" dans le clique droit
J'ai essayé les 2, la synchro fonctionne, tout mes paquets sont bien récupérés par le dépot distant MAIS depuis la console ca indique encore en erreur alors que tout fonctionne
Debian 11
WAPT Version : 2.4.0.14143
Verrouillé